Verb[edit]

ка́чвам (káčvam) first-singular present indicativeimpf (perfective кача́)

  1. to put (something up somewhere, in a higher location)
  2. to put (someone/something into/onto a vehicle)
  3. (figurative) to raise (temperature, prices)
  4. (figurative) to rise up, to revolt
  5. (figurative) to gain (weight)
  6. (figurative, colloquial) to promote (someone)
  7. (computing) to upload
  8. (reflexive with се) to go up (to a higher location), to climb
  9. (reflexive with се) to get (into/onto a vehicle or horse)
  10. (reflexive with се) to rise (of temperature, prices)
